Asthma is a chronic and common condition of the airways affecting many people of all ages.
Across the UK the number of people receiving treatment for asthma is in the region of 5.4m, with a person in one in five households suffering from the condition. Everyone is different and taking preventative measures to avoid asthma attacks and other complications begins by understanding the causes and the many triggers of asthma.
